It's official. I can't fit my full-size tree (and its full-size collection of ornaments) in my tiny living room. Not and still have room to sit down. I will have to get a smaller tree that I can stand on the end table in the corner, temporarily sacrificing my reading lamp. Thus, I will also have to get some smaller ornaments. I've been using the same old ornaments for the past twenty years; time for something new anyway.
So off to the crafts store I went.
I now have: 24 little straw brooms. 13 grapevine wreaths, about 3" across. A bag of cinnamon sticks about 3" long. A bag of pine cones. A bag of mixed nuts. 10 picks with small fruits (apples, pears and cherries) encrusted with sparkles. Plus an assortment of narrow holiday ribbons, tiny holly leaf garland, metallic gold embroidery thread, spray on glitter, and a hot glue gun.
Out of this assembly there will eventually emerge: Sparkly fruits removed from the picks. Sparkly nuts. Sparkly pinecones. Sparkly sunwheels made with grapevine wreaths and cinnamon-stick crosses. Sparkly brooms with red, white and green ribbons. Maybe some God's Eyes made with cinnamon sticks and ribbons. Maybe some sparkly pentagrams made with cinnamon sticks. Everything on gold cord loops with little bits of holly at the tops of each item to hide the place where the cords are attached.
